Scratch官方是一款专为青少年设计的图形化编程学习平台,通过拖拽积木块的方式,让编程变得像搭积木一样简单有趣,旨在激发孩子们的创造力和逻辑思维能力。
1. 易于上手:Scratch采用直观的图形化界面,无需编写复杂的代码,降低了编程的门槛,使初学者能够快速入门。
2. 创意无限:提供了丰富的角色、背景、声音等素材库,以及强大的编程功能,支持用户自由创作各种动画、游戏和交互故事。
3. 社区支持:Scratch拥有庞大的全球用户社区,孩子们可以分享自己的作品,相互学习,激发更多的创意灵感。
4. 教育价值高:不仅教会孩子们编程知识,还培养了他们的解决问题能力、团队协作精神和创新思维。
1. 积木式编程:将复杂的编程逻辑简化为可拖拽的积木块,通过组合不同的积木块来实现功能。
2. 多媒体支持:支持图片、声音、视频等多种媒体素材的导入和使用,让作品更加生动有趣。
3. 跨平台兼容:无论是在Windows、Mac还是Linux系统上,都能流畅运行,方便用户随时随地进行创作。
4. 开放式接口:提供API接口,支持与其他软件和硬件的集成,扩展了Scratch的应用场景和可能性。
1. 角色设计:首先创建或导入角色,为角色添加动作和表情,使其具有生命力。
2. 场景搭建:选择或绘制背景,设置舞台布局,为故事或游戏设定合适的场景。
3. 编程控制:通过拖拽积木块编写脚本,控制角色的移动、跳跃、交互等行为,实现游戏逻辑。
4. 测试与调试:运行程序,观察效果,根据需要进行调整和优化,直到达到满意的效果。
1. 教育意义深远:Scratch不仅是一款编程工具,更是一个培养未来创新人才的摇篮,值得广泛推广。
2. 用户体验良好:界面友好,操作简单,即使是没有编程基础的孩子也能快速上手,享受编程的乐趣。
3. 社区氛围浓厚:Scratch社区充满活力和创意,孩子们在这里可以找到志同道合的伙伴,共同成长。
4. 持续改进与创新:Scratch官方团队不断更新和完善软件功能,引入新技术和理念,保持软件的竞争力和吸引力。
对于您的问题快深感抱歉,非常感谢您的举报反馈,小编一定会及时处理该问题,同时希望能尽可能的填写全面,方便小编检查具体的问题所在,及时处理,再次感谢!